I pulled some ham out of the freezer and cubed it up... then i cut up broccoli and cauliflower and a onion (the veggies were a good half of the dish) I added in some par cooked bow tie pasta (my daughters choice) and i made a cheese sauce with tons and tons of old and extra old cheddar cheese and added salt and pepper... i made the sauce off the hook cheesy... then i put a bit more on top... it filled a 10 X 13 pan and i don't have to cook again for a bit... I can't wait to dive in it smells so good (i let my daughter lick off the spatula with cheese sauce on it... she stopped talking completely until she licked it clean and asked how long until it is ready!) LOL you know it is good when you get the sound of silence!
If you try this make sure to make your cheese sauce thick... the veggies will give off some moisture! Mine was thick but still stirred in easily and it came out perfect.

I had a bunch of blade steak to use up so I threw it in the slow cooker this morning. I lined the bottom with sliced onion & minced garlic and then added a can of diced tomatoes, spices, a squirt of this and that from the fridge i.e. bbq sauce, honey mustard, hot sauce. Usually around the 6-7 hr I will take out the meat, and remove all the onion and tomatoes etc and shred the meat and then put back in the juice to continue cooking. And if there are a few people around later there will be lots to put on fresh buns with some cheddar or at least something for sandwiches on the weekend
But I have to say I was astonished at the sodium content in the tomatoes--I didn't look at it until after I put them in; I prob won't use them again i.e 796ml can, 400 mg of sodium per 1/2 cup (125ml) = 2500+mg of sodium-- that is insane!!
